Britannia Arms San Jose
173 W. Santa Clara St., San Jose CA 95113Britannia Arms epitomizes the local bar in the British pub tradition bringing it to downtown San Jose packed with diners and drinkers making nice with the crown. Britannia Arms sports an impressive import tap beer list with some domestics thrown in for less discerning palates and the liquor selection—especially the scotch and whiskey collections from the Isles—isn't too shabby either. On the weekends patrons cram into this downtown San Jose bar for the singles scene, the DJ fueled dancing and live music acts of both the original and cover band varieties while earlier in the week Britannia Arms restaurant and bar caters to belt it out karaoke crooners and wannabe rockstars. Patrons of all stripes also hit The Brit for some down home British Isle fare like fish and chips, bangers and shepherds pie, but since this bar resides in California there are numerous healthier options on the menu right alongside Britannia Arms' traditional artery clogging favorites.

Agenda Lounge
399 S. 1st St., San Jose CA 95113; Tel. 408.380.3042Agenda Lounge is an institution of the SoFA district of downtown San Jose. Both a restaurant and a steamy dance club, nightlife seekers can enjoy a fine meal downstairs before they ascend to the nightclub portion to dance the night away. This San Jose dance club books top DJs who regularly spin steamy R&B and thumping house beats. For their Latin themed Wednesday nights, Agenda is also considered one of the best places for San Jose salsa dancing. Free salsa dance classes are offered before the open dancing starts, giving newbies a chance to learn something snazzy to show off on the floor.

Caravan
98 S. Almaden Ave., San Jose CA 95113; Tel. 408.995.6220The undisputed king of San Jose dive bars, the Caravan is a downtown San Jose institution that would be deeply mourned if ever lost. This place has been slinging brews and potent cocktails to a diverse set of patrons for what seems like forever, all for prices that keep even the broke locals in a happy state of drunkenness. DJs and live bands provide a soundtrack for drinking escapades several nights a week, while other nights see patrons chatting up the bartenders, shooting pool and listening to everything from Marilyn Manson to Stevie Wonder on the jukebox.

Trials Pub
265 N. 1st St., San Jose CA 95113; Tel. 408.947.0497Outfitted in every way like a cozy neighborhood pub, Trials offers a warm, friendly atmosphere to the downtown San Jose bar scene. Friendly bartenders, comfy furniture, a tiny patio area, a lengthy bar with plenty of seats and ample seating near a fireplace in the back half combine to offer beer enthusiasts a setting that feels like home. Trials also offers above-average bar food, with the curry and the fish & chips being the most popular items on the menu.
